Reminded of his words in a Hong Kong hotel room when he learned that Barack Obama had won elecetion -- "My God, we did it, we did it'' -- retired Army Gen. Colin Powell, former

"It was an electric moment for me, and I think for the country,'' Powell said in an interview this morning with NBC News' Matt Lauer. "There were so many people who said, 'You know, they'll go in the booth, and they really won't pull the lever for a black man'... There were people around the world who said America is too polarized... and we can't come together to do this. And we did it..''

Powell, who served as chairman of the Joint Chiefs of Staff for one president and secretary of state for another, calls Obama ready for duty as commander-in-chief.

"He's fully qualified, and he also happens to be African-American.'' Powell said. "I put it in that order.''

"I think he's starting off with the strong support of the American people,'' Powell said. "America has said, 'OK, this is our decision... now let's come together.'... We have a new spirit in our country.''
